Champaign County’s grant coordinator told the board that a months‑long stop‑payment listing tied to delayed audit work prevented grant submissions and reimbursements, and staff summarized ARPA project reporting and upcoming small‑business grant deadlines.

CHAMPAIGN, Ill. — The county’s grant coordinator told the Champaign County Board on Wednesday that a three‑month stop‑payment listing tied to a delayed audit prevented her from submitting reimbursement grants and applying for some opportunities, and she urged tighter operational coordination to avoid future interruptions.
